Syrian Ambassador to the United Nations Dr. Bashar Jaafari stressed that the briefing provided by Valerie Amos, under-Secretary-General for Humanitarian Affairs to Syria about the humanitarian situation there was not accurate: it was false and incomplete and not worthy of the post of Solicitor General of the United Nations for humanitarian affairs nor does it show the latest serious developments on the ground. Jaafari said at a news conference after a meeting of the UN Security Council that Amos did not address the scandal surrounding toxic vaccines in rural Idleb that claimed the lives of dozens of children and for which the WFP was responsible - as the WFP was given access to the cities of Raqqa and Deir ez-Zor. Jaafari added Amos did not mention the word terrorist and spoke instead about the armed opposition groups, ignoring the international decision 2178 and ignored the mortar shells on civilian neighborhoods by terrorists. In response to a question about the transfer of UNDOF headquarters for the Golan from Damascus, Al-Jaafari said there was a suggestion within the Department of peacekeeping operations to move the headquarters of UNDOF to the Israeli side: this is contrary to the disengagement agreement of 1974; the Syrian Government explained to them that this is inadmissible and that UNDOF headquarters for the Syrian territory and the Golan Heights Syrian land occupied by Israel must be in Damascus. Jaafari added that the Syrian side of the separation line in Golan is now under the control of terrorists sponsored by Israel, Qatar, Saudi Arabia and Jordan.
